The Joint Service Pay Readjustment Act of 1922 is a law dealing with compensation for the United States armed services. It was signed into law by President Harding on June 10, 1922. Prior to enactment, separate pay legislation for the United States Army and Navy was the norm. With the law, Congress attempted to deal with compensation for all the armed services in a comprehensive manner in response to higher living costs. Officers were now to be paid in pay periods rather than quarterly or yearly
